2. Why the Jellyfish Lamp Feels So Relaxing (Nighttime Magic Unfolded)
The Jellyfish Lamp’s relaxation power isn’t just luck—it’s in how it targets your senses, especially at night when your body is ready to unwind:
- Slow, Ocean-Like Motion: The silicone jellyfish float in a soft, swaying rhythm—exactly like real jellyfish gliding through calm ocean waters. At night, when your brain is tired of screens and noise, this slow motion acts like a “mental reset button”: it distracts from racing thoughts without overstimulating, letting your mind drift into a calmer state.
- Soft, Dim Light That Mimics Ocean Glow: Harsh bedroom lights (like overhead bulbs or phone screens) trick your brain into staying awake. The Jellyfish Lamp’s dimmable RGB light lets you pick soft blues, pale purples, or warm teals—hues that mirror the ocean at dusk or dawn. This light signals to your body, “It’s time to relax,” not “It’s time to stay alert.”
- Quiet That Feels Like the Ocean: Unlike loud fans or white noise machines, the lamp’s pump is nearly silent (under 30 decibels). The only “sound” is the subtle visual of jellyfish moving—like the quiet of the ocean at night, where calm feels tangible. It’s the kind of quiet that lets your body release tension without distraction.

3. How to Use the Jellyfish Lamp for the Ultimate Bedroom Ocean Vibe
Getting that “dreamy ocean bedroom” feel doesn’t take work—just a few small tweaks to how you use the lamp:
- Pick the Right Color: For an ocean vibe, skip bright whites or bold reds. Go for soft sky blue (mimics shallow ocean waters) or pale teal (like deep ocean calm). If you want coziness, mix in a hint of warm yellow (like sunlight filtering through waves).
- Place It Where You Can See It Easily: Put the lamp on your nightstand, or on a shelf across from your bed. You don’t need to stare at it—just having it in your peripheral vision as you read, scroll (sparingly!), or lie down will make the ocean vibe sink in. The goal is to let the light and motion wrap around you, not demand your attention.
- Pair It with Gentle Sounds (Optional): For extra ocean magic, play soft wave sounds (via a phone app or small speaker) while the lamp is on. The combination of visual and audio turns your bedroom into a mini ocean retreat—no travel needed.
- Turn It On 15 Minutes Before Bed: Give your body time to adjust to the calm. Turning the lamp on before you’re ready to sleep lets your cortisol (stress hormone) drop, so you’re already relaxed when you lie down—making it easier to fall asleep.

5. FAQs: Using the Jellyfish Lamp in Bedrooms
Q1: Will the Jellyfish Lamp’s light keep me awake?
A1: No—if you use the right settings! Keep the brightness low (under 20 lumens) and choose soft, cool hues (like blue or purple). These colors don’t disrupt melatonin (the sleep hormone) the way bright white light does. Avoid color cycling at night—stick to one calm color.
Q2: Can I leave the Jellyfish Lamp on all night?
A2: Yes! Most models are designed for 24/7 use and have built-in overheat protection. The LED light stays cool, so it won’t overheat or pose a risk. Many people leave it on as a nightlight—its soft glow makes midnight trips to the bathroom easier without jarring you awake.
Q3: How do I clean the lamp if it’s on my nightstand (where I keep drinks/books)?
A3: Wipe the tank with a dry, soft cloth if it gets dusty. If you spill something on the base, use a slightly damp cloth (not wet!) to clean it—just make sure you unplug the lamp first. The silicone jellyfish can be rinsed with warm water if they get dirty (let them dry fully before putting them back).
